drop
nounmasculinegeneral usevery common/ˈpĩɡu/pin·go
Definition
1A very small quantity of a liquid; a droplet.
Usage examples
“A drop of rain fell on his forehead.”
“Just a drop of olive oil is enough to dress the salad.”
Common combinations
drop of waterdrop of raindrop of oilwithout a drop
Idiomatic expressions
- Not worth a drop (worthless)
- A drop in the bucket (a tiny part of something large)
